The SR 2050 IEM-GW is a rock-solid wireless IEM system built for serious stage performers and monitor engineers. Its clean audio, excellent RF performance, and flexible channel management make it a great choice for bands and venues needing reliable, professional-grade monitoring—especially where frequency congestion is a concern. It’s a step up from entry-level systems and delivers true pro-level reliability.

Product Description

  • Sennheiser SR 2050 IEM-GW
  • 2-channel UHF stereo IEM transmitter
  • Frequency range: 558 - 626 MHz
  • 75 MHz switching bandwidth
  • 26 Banks with up to 32 channels
  • HDX compander system
  • Switchable output power 10/30/50/100 mW
  • Ethernet connection
  • Format: 19" / 1HE
PROS
  • • Excellent RF stability even in crowded wireless environments.
  • • HDX compander provides clean, dynamic audio with minimal noise.
  • • Flexible channel bank system simplifies frequency coordination for multiple users.
  • • Robust 19in rackmount design allows for seamless integration into professional rigs.
CONS
  • • Premium-priced, representing a significant investment for smaller operations.
  • • Limited frequency band compared to some competing systems, potentially restricting channel availability.
  • • Ethernet connectivity adds complexity; may not be essential for all users.
